Even as lots of people breathe a sigh of relief following a conclusion of the tax period, folks foreign accounts and other foreign financial assets may not yet be through using tax reporting. The Foreign Bank Account Report (FBAR) arrives by June 30th for all qualifying citizens. The FBAR is a disclosure form that is filled by all U.S. citizens, residents, and U.S. entities that own bank accounts, are bank signatories to such accounts, or have a controlling stakes to at least or many foreign bank accounts physically situated outside the borders of this country. The report also includes foreign financial assets, life insurance policies, annuity with a cash value, pool funds, and mutual funds.

What concerning your income taxes? As per the actual IRS policies, the volume debt relief that acquire is consideration to be your income. This is because of males that you were supposed to cover that money to the creditor a person did not always. This amount on the money that you don't pay then becomes your taxable income. The government will tax this money along the actual use of other net income. Just in case you were insolvent the particular settlement deal, you should try to pay any taxes on that relief money. Avoided that if ever the amount of debts that you had inside settlement was greater how the value of your total assets, you don't need to pay tax on the amount that was eliminated out of dues. However, you should report this to federal government. If you don't, you will be after tax.
